Combatting COVID-19: Dubai shuts down swimming pool; fines fitness centres

Supplied

A swimming pool at a sports centre in Dubai has been shut down for not complying with COVID-19 safety protocols.

Authorities have also fined two fitness centres for a similar offence.

They were pulled up for not ensuring safe distance inside the facilities and also because an employee was not wearing a face mask.

The violations were found during field visits carried out by teams from Dubai Sports Council and Dubai Economy.

Inspections will be intensified in the coming days to ensure all sports and fitness centres are following the rules.
